In 2018, Timesheet Mobile integrated ChargeOver to manage its billing functions, deploying ChargeOver as the Subscription and Recurring Billing solution for the Timesheet Mobile platform. Timesheet Mobile used ChargeOver’s API to connect its software platform directly to ChargeOver’s billing solution, establishing a programmatic interface between timesheet customer accounts and subscription billing processes.
The implementation focused on standard Subscription and Recurring Billing workflows, using ChargeOver’s API to create and manage subscriptions, generate recurring invoices, and drive automated billing cycles and event-driven account updates. ChargeOver served as the centralized billing engine while Timesheet Mobile retained its core professional services application logic.
Operationally the integration embedded ChargeOver into Timesheet Mobile’s customer account and billing flows, enabling programmatic control of subscription lifecycle actions from the application layer. Governance concentrated on API-driven orchestration and synchronized billing state between the Timesheet Mobile platform and ChargeOver, aligning product invoicing with subscription management workflows.

In 2017, Timesheet Mobile deployed Zendesk Chat on their website as the primary customer-facing conversational interface. Zendesk Chat is implemented as a web-embedded chat widget paired with a browser-based agent console, classified in the Chatbots and Conversational AI category. The deployment emphasizes real-time messaging, visitor-initiated sessions, and on-screen engagement prompts, with configuration of presence and availability to match the small internal support team. Implementation concentrated on browser integration and session management rather than broad platform orchestration.
The configuration uses Chatbots and Conversational AI capabilities such as canned responses, automated triggers tied to visitor behavior, and transcript capture, with chat records retained in the Zendesk Chat interface for agent follow-up. Operational scope is centered on the Timesheet Mobile website and impacts customer support and sales inquiry workflows managed by the internal team. Governance is operationally lightweight, relying on agent assignment, response templates, and published availability schedules to control routing and escalation of live conversations.

In 2014, Timesheet Mobile implemented GoDaddy Webmail as its primary Collaboration application. Timesheet Mobile uses GoDaddy Webmail to provide domain-based email and webmail access for company staff, positioning GoDaddy Webmail as the central Collaboration tool for corporate communications.
Deployment is hosted through GoDaddy under the company domain, with user accounts provisioned and managed in the GoDaddy control panel and email routing configured at the DNS level via MX records to enable inbound mail delivery. Functional capabilities align with Collaboration expectations, including web-accessible inboxes, calendar and contacts synchronization typical of hosted webmail, and standard SMTP outbound mail flows. Operational coverage is the Timesheet Mobile organization in the United States, supporting core administrative and operational communications across its eight employees. Governance and operational control are handled through account-level administration in the vendor portal, with designated administrative users responsible for account provisioning, password management, and DNS updates.
